The Impact of AI on Ecommerce 

The online retail industry has undergone a remarkable transformation with the widespread adoption of AI. Online shopping experiences have become more seamless and personalized, catering to the unique needs and preferences of consumers. This shift is largely driven by the power of AI, which allows retailers to meet customer expectations in an efficient and effective manner.

One of the key impacts of AI on online shopping is the ability to deliver highly personalized experiences. By leveraging AI algorithms, retailers can analyze vast amounts of data to understand individual customer preferences and behaviors. This enables them to offer tailored recommendations, promotions, and advertisements, elevating the overall shopping experience.

In addition to ecommerce personalization, AI has also significantly improved operational efficiencies for online retailers. AI-powered solutions optimize inventory management, automate supply chain processes, and streamline order fulfillment. These advancements minimize costs, increase productivity, and enable retailers to make data-driven decisions based on insights gathered from AI analysis.

Moreover, AI has revolutionized the customer experience in online shopping. Conversational AI tools, such as chatbots, provide immediate and helpful responses to customer inquiries, while virtual assistants guide shoppers throughout their journey. These technologies not only enhance the overall shopping experience, but also generate valuable customer data that helps retailers understand preferences and purchasing patterns.

The impact of AI on online retail is far-reaching, transforming the way businesses operate and interact with customers. With AI-driven personalization, optimized operations, and enhanced customer experiences, online retailers are better equipped to meet the demands of today's shoppers and drive business growth.

Demand Forecasting

AI can significantly improve demand forecasting in ecommerce by leveraging advanced algorithms and data analysis techniques. 

There isn’t a more important time to get your product inventory correct than Black Friday weekend. AI-powered forecasting models can analyze large volumes of historical sales data, market trends, customer behavior, and other relevant factors to make accurate predictions about the demand needed to satisfy online shoppers on Black Friday. This helps ecommerce businesses optimize inventory levels and ensure product availability.

AI algorithms can also continuously monitor and analyze real-time data from various sources, such as social media, customer feedback, competitor pricing, and website traffic. This enables ecommerce businesses to quickly adapt their demand forecasting strategies based on changing market conditions.

Additionally, AI can identify patterns and correlations in complex datasets that humans may overlook. By integrating external data sources such as weather forecasts, economic indicators, and social media trends, AI can provide a more holistic view of demand drivers and help businesses anticipate demand fluctuations.

AI's ability to analyze vast amounts of data and learn from patterns and trends makes it a powerful tool for improving demand forecasting in ecommerce. It enables businesses to make informed decisions, reduce stockouts, minimize inventory carrying costs, and provide better customer experiences.

Chatbots and Virtual Assistants

Thanks to the power of generative AI, conversational commerce is making offering a connected customer experience for your webshop much easier. 

Conversational commerce is the process of using automated conversations and technologies — with the help of AI — to create more engaging customer experiences while shopping online. This includes using chatbots and virtual assistants to power on-site conversations that assist with customer support or checkout. 

Why is this important on Black Friday? The ability to offer 24/7 customer support via AI when your website is buzzing with customers will allow your commerce-driving team the time and freedom to work on more important tasks. The conversational AI will be able to address common questions and concerns instantly for curious customers, even outside of normal hours. 

These AI-powered chatbots can analyze customer inquiries in real time and provide responses instantly. They can handle a wide range of frequently asked questions, such as order tracking, product information, shipping details, and returns or exchanges.This engagement ensures that customers are having a good experience with your brand on Black Friday and helps your commerce-driving team scale its efforts by relying on AI to handle high volumes of queries and interactions from customers. Customer Segmentation 

Are you sending the right marketing campaigns to the right customers in advance of Black Friday? AI plays a crucial role in customer segmentation by enabling brands to analyze vast amounts of data and identify patterns that would be challenging for humans to recognize manually. 

AI-powered systems can gather data from multiple sources, including customer interactions, purchase history, website behavior, social media, and more. This data is then integrated and organized to create a comprehensive customer profile, or single customer view

AI algorithms can analyze the collected data to identify patterns and trends among different customer groups. It can detect correlations between various customer attributes, behaviors, and preferences.

Since AI systems can process data in real time, brands are able to respond quickly to changing customer behaviors and preferences. This ensures that the messages sent are always relevant and up to date. So when your Black Friday marketing messages are going out, you can rest assured that your customer segments are updated and your customers aren’t receiving irrelevant marketing materials.  

AI can even predict customer behavior based on historical data and patterns. This helps with anticipating customer needs and preferences, enabling brands to proactively reach out to customers with tailored messages.

Plus, you can use AI algorithms to automatically segment customers into distinct groups based on similarities in their characteristics and behaviors. This segmentation allows brands to tailor their messaging for each group, ensuring that customers receive communications that resonate with them.
